Okay I was in LoweRiders yesterday talking to Andy about a bike I am looking at.

Here is what is happening --they have started a tri club and it can be found here www.cctri-fit.com

They are/ will be having clinics the 1 st wednesday of the month.

They are registered with USA Triathlon

From their webpage--

The Chester County Tri-Fit Club was created as a resource for those interested in participating in triathlons, and triathletes looking for an organization to assist them with their training and equipment needs.  The organizations main goal is to encourage physical activity and fitness for individuals and families in and around Chester County.  Club leaders include:

Andy Lowe, Professional Bike Fitter and Owner Loweriders Bikes & Boards

Chris Marino, Master Fitness Trainer and Owner CDM Personal Training

Tom Captis, Triathlon Guru & Coach, and Andy Lowe Certified Bike Technician

Kevin & Mary Matthews, Downingtown Running Company

Jeremy Sherin, Swim Instructor – CPT, ACAC Fitness & Wellness Center
